    Yup, Mazda Q85 is special.
    -Recognized Substitutes:
    Motolite 1SMF/NS50ZZL/D23L
    AC DELCO: SQ85D23LEFB
    -Cost: Php15-25ish K
    -Life is dependent on usage.
    -Reasons why a specific battery for i-stop system is necessary
     When a vehicle equipped with i-stop system stops at a red light, engine is stopped for fuel
    economy improvement. When the vehicle starts to drive again, the engine restarts. So, battery discharging and charging are repeated in a short period of time.
     Also, during i-stop operation, as electric power for air conditioning and audio systems etc. is supplied from the battery only, discharging occurs more than on vehicles without i-stop
    system.
     If a battery other than the specifically designed for i-stop is used instead, its lifecycle may be reduced or it may disable i-stop function.

    -Lowdown on differences between Q85 & regular batt:
    It has improved durability/charging acceptability. In order to achieve these performances, it
    has the following features.
    ① More durability
    (1) With the use of narrow grid, holding capacity of active material is raised to prevent active material from becoming softened and dropping.
    (2) Charging ability is improved by reducing sulfation due to discharging.
    ※Sulfation :At this condition, battery cannot be reduced to lead and sulfuric acid even after charging because lead sulfate, which is generated during battery discharging, causes coarsening in the recrystallization process.
    Recrystallization progresses gradually. So, by keeping the discharging condition (with more lead sulfate included) for a long time, sulfation occurs, which lowers battery capacity or charging ability.

    ② More charging ability
    (1) Additive included in lead of battery plate
    is optimized to increase charging
    performance.
    (2) Reaction area is increased by having
    more battery plates to improve charging
    performance.
    On the other hand, though charging acceptability has increased with more battery plates, dendrite short is more likely to occur due to smaller gap between battery plates!
    ※Dendrite short: If sulfuric acid concentration in the electrolyte solution decreases battery is exhaustively discharged. At that time, lead ion dissolves from lead sulfate. If
    the battery is charged under such condition, lead ion grows and becomes like a shape of a needle on the (-) battery plate surface, which is called dendrite.



    Why Shell Fuel Save? Technically, SkyActiv is not your regular direct injection engine. This is a hi-comp engine that runs on regular unleaded w/o the dreaded knock. To ensure smooth long running service, efficiency & yojin warranty retention, it's ideal to stick w/ what Mazda has endorsed. After all, going above the required octane won't add gains nor benefits, only cost.

    Direct injection engines are known to be prone to fuel system, combustion chamber, intake & valve carbon deposits. Eventually, these engines will need walnut media blasting. However, there are fuel system cleaning additives out there that techs & enthusiasts swear by....Seafoam, Techron & BG44 are some of the better known fuel system cleaners. I'm hoping Mazda PH carries this fuel system cleaning additive that's being sold in Jp, Sg & other markets.....

    Details:
    Deposit Cleaner is an engine combustion chamber cleaner for non-rotary petrol only. Added into the fuel tank to prevent deposits on fuel injector nozzles, intake valves, plugs & combustion chamber.
